Necesito renombrar carpetas y subcarpetas desde un archivo excel

Necesito renombrar carpetas y subcarpetas desde un archivo excel. El nombre de las carpetas ha renombrar están en la primera columna con toda la ruta,  y en la segunda columna están los nombres nuevos con toda la ruta.

Agradecería colaboración

1 Respuesta

Respuesta

La instrucción que necesitas utilizar es: NAME nbre_ant AS nbre_nvo

Para realizar los cambios en toda la col, imaginemos A y B, podes utilizar este bucle que finaliza cuando en A no encuentre más datos.

Sub renombra_carpetas()
'x Elsamatilde
'recorre la col A hasta encontrar celda vacìa
'empiezo en fila 2
Range("A2").Select
'contemplo posible error de ruta o nombre invalido
On Error Resume Next
While ActiveCell <> ""
'cambia el nombre por la de la col B
Name ActiveCell.Value As ActiveCell.Offset(0, 1).Value
'paso a la fila sgte
ActiveCell.Offset(1, 0).Select
'repito el bucle
Wend
'opcional:
MsgBox "Fin del proceso de cambios."
End Sub

Si todo queda resuelto no olvides valorar y finalizar la consulta.

Te recuerdo que la consulta sigue abierta.

Si ya pudiste probarla y responde a tu consulta no olvides valorarla y finalizarla.

Sdos

Elsa

Añade tu respuesta

Haz clic para o

Más respuestas relacionadas